7) change in the nucleotide sequence can change the genetic message in DNA which in turn can cause change in the genetic code in mRNA. Change in genetic code will result in incorporation of different triplet codon in mRNA which will code for amino acid different than what would normally found in the protien. Incorporation of different amino acid in polypeptide chain, changes the entire protien structure.
Example;
Sickle cell amemia results due to abnormal structure in beta chain of haemoglobin. Haemoglobin is formed of 4 polypeptide chains; 2 alpha and 2 beta chains and each chain is encoded by different gene.
Beta chain is encoded by gene located on chromosome 11. Sickle cell anemia is caused due to mutation in the beta-haemoglobin gene on chromosome 11. In normal gene, sequence CTC in DNA is transcribed into codon CAG that codes for amino acid glutamic acid at the 6th position in beta chain. Due to susbtitution mutation,there occurs change in nucleotide sequence in DNA. Thiamine (T) is replaced by Adenine (A) in second position of sequence CTC Which chnages this sequence into CAC. This (CAC) sequence is transcribed into codon GUG, Which codes for valine.
Thus amino acid valine is incorporated at the 6th position of beta chain of haemoglobin instead of glutamic acid. Valine at the 6th positiin form hydrophobic bonds with complemetary sites of other globin molecules producing a haemoglobin molecule called as sickle cell haemoglobin.
